About Sedat Öktem
Sedat Öktem is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Physiology, Surgery, Genetics and Pathology and Forensic Medicine, having authored 44 papers that have together received 350 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Tracheal and airway disorders (7 papers), Neurogenetic and Muscular Disorders Research (5 papers), Asthma and respiratory diseases (5 papers), Respiratory Support and Mechanisms (4 papers), Airway Management and Intubation Techniques (4 papers), Cystic Fibrosis Research Advances (3 papers), Congenital Diaphragmatic Hernia Studies (3 papers) and Inhalation and Respiratory Drug Delivery (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(148 citations),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(22 citations), Physiology (48 citations), Neurology (22 citations) and Microbiology (1 citation). Sedat Öktem has collaborated with scholars based in Türkiye and United States. Frequent co-authors include Fazi̇let Karakoç, Gülnür Tokuç, Refika Ersu, Bülent Karadağ, Perran Boran, Zeynep Seda Uyan, Elif Dağlı, Erkan Çakır, Özlem Bostan and Gürsu Kıyan. Their work appears in journals such as Pediatric Pulmonology, International Journal of Pediatric Otorhinolaryngology, Jornal de Pediatria, Journal of Cystic Fibrosis and Acta Oncologica.
